About Us.....

Young Potential was founded in 2000 by a small passionate team of youth workers with years of experience of working with young people in difficult situations and a burning ambition to spend our time making sure that young people who grow up facing poverty, poor living conditions, neglect, abuse and insecurity can still get the best of chances to get an education and a job. We do this so that they can have a better future and not rely on crime and drugs in order to survive as adults.

We work directly with young people, but we also work with adults who they come into contact with, including their families, professional workers and other people who live in their local communities, because these are the people who can make or break the life chances of these vulnerable young people.

We centre our work around developing emotional resilience, helping people to understand and then cope better with the way that they feel about the situations that they find themselves in.  Then we work on developing empathy, understanding and a sense of responsibility so people start to see that what they do affects others, and in turn, affects the way others see them.

We find that once the young people start to feel better about themselves, they start to treat other people better, then start to care about the people and places around them, and before long they are wanting to get back to school, 'sort themselves out' and look forward to the sort of future that everyone would wish for our children.

A good number of the young people that we work with go on to become volunteers in their own communities, giving up a considerable amount of their own free time to help make life better for others.

We are proud to be an organisation that believes in young people and in their future

We have been a Registered Charity since 2001, our number is 1087787

Our job is ......

To improve the opportunities of all young people, but in particular those who are involved with crime, have problems relating to drug, solvent or alcohol abuse or related issues or who are excluded from school or other circumstances.

We provide a range of activities and services that provide intensive, realistic and consistent guidance and support to young people aged 13 and over, whose lives are seriously affected by crime, violence, poverty or neglect.

We specialise in a unique set of intensive behavioural management interventions which we deliver in both school and community settings, working directly with young people, their families, carers and professional workers.
